The Washington Capitals will have a weekend off to prepare for the Stanley Cup playoffs.

Alex Ovechkin and company open the postseason against the Montreal Canadiens on Monday night at Capital One Arena, the NHL announced Thursday.

The Capitals, as the top seed in the Eastern Conference, will host the Canadiens for Game 1 on Monday and Game 2 on Wednesday before the series shifts to Montreal. The Canadiens will host Games 3 and 4 on Friday, April 25, and Sunday, April 27.



The remaining “if necessary” games will alternate between the District and Montreal. Washington would host Games 5 and 7 on Wednesday, April 30, and Sunday, May 4. Game 6 would be played in Montreal on Friday, May 2.

If they beat the Canadiens, the Capitals would maintain their home-ice advantage through the next two rounds of the playoffs.
